You're absolutely right, winter tires do offer better performance in cold weather, but I still think that should be the choice of the driver and not enforced by law. For all the benefits winter tires provide below zero, they offer an opposite effect when the temperature rises. So what about all the drivers who try to 'kill off' the last of their winter tires by driving them through the spring? Consumer Reports found that winter tires have a much longer braking distance than even all-seasons as the temp rises, so then do we mandate that all people have summer tires?
